Fha Home Mortgage What Are FHA Home Loans? An FHA insured home loan is considered one of the best loan choices available today for any homebuyer seeking a low down payment combined with relatively easy qualifying standards. The Federal Housing Administration is part of the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D).

What are FHA house loans – How to Apply for & FHA Mortgage Requirements An FHA loan is a type of government insured mortgage. FHA loans do not normally require a large downpayment and may have many advantages over conventional loans.

The FHA allows a total debt ratio of 41%, but if you can keep it well below that, it can work in your favor. Reserves – The FHA doesn’t require you to have reserves on hand when you get an FHA loan, but they can’t hurt.
